Output bef40d4e33ea6fa8560023cbce6c46286b63b671eb8a762485d05f1ef1d8971d:10

value
20362112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c1b6243c95c44ab9f454f12047da66df9a7f674 OP_EQUAL
address
3Qg31YjuZqE4qDbRz7FkSTaAtoe1JZowJY
transaction
bef40d4e33ea6fa8560023cbce6c46286b63b671eb8a762485d05f1ef1d8971d
confirmations
276332
spent
true